Firefox search plugin - Mininova ordered by seeds

When there are a lot of resulting torrents for a search on mininova I always end up resorting them by seeds to force the best results to the top (hurray for the accidental power of the social web!), so I modified the existing mininova search plugin to save myself a step.
Click here to download - or don’t, I really couldn’t care less!

 Installation: Save the file to Mozilla’s “searchplugins” directory (either in the shared application directory or inside your profile), and restart your browser. All done :)
